If you’ve been wondering what all the buzz is about around zero waste and sustainability, then you’re gonna love what I’m serving up for you today...Carly Bergman is a vegan and zero waste advocate who studied sustainability and eco-spirituality at Florida Gulf Coast University, and is certified in permaculture design. Together with her boyfriend, Brendan, she founded Sustainable Duo, a brand that makes sustainability trendy and helps people to connect more with nature while providing common but sustainable everyday items that are usually made of plastic, like eating utensils, toothbrushes, and hygiene kits. Welcome to episode 9 of ‘Happiness from Within’. In today’s episode I talk to Carly Bergman, a vegan and zero waste advocate who has placed sustainability at the heart of her beliefs. Together with her boyfriend Brendan she founded Sustainable Duo, a company that makes sustainability trendy and helps people connect and take care of the Earth.   Key takeaways: The real duo is the relationship between you and the planet Things can be trendy and sustainable Sustainability is about being resourceful You can create a beautiful wedding that does no harm to the planet Just because something is vegan does not mean it’s healthy Communication is the key to working together as a couple   Carly discovered the world of veganism and sustainability when she started working for a raw vegan juice bar at the age of 16. All the different insights she gained from her coworkers influenced her immensely and she decided to pursue a degree in permaculture and create sustainable and ‘smart’ gardens.   After meeting her boyfriend Brendan at a vegan festival, the couple founded their first company Sustainable Duo Zero Waste, which makes turns items into sustainable products but with a trendy and fashionable feel to it. Examples include sustainable, cutlery, straws and other items which are usually plastic. Their mission is to connect people back with Earth, and this means first taking care of our planet. The couple then founded a second company called Plant Protein which produces holistic protein bars which are not only vegan, but also sustainable. Amelia chats with Carly Bergman and Brenden Fitzgerald, AKA @sustainable_duo about zero waste and minimalist living, the joys of eating from the earth, sustainable food growing, connecting to the earth and eco-spirituality, and conscious entrepreneurship. We dive into: - Carly and Brenden's contrasting roots/upbringing and how they each found veganism and sustainable/minimalist living, and each other - How and why Brenden went from eating a heavy meat-based diet his whole life to vegan overnight (he's got great tips for those who don't like/aren't used to eating plants) - How living authentically and in alignment with your values and your truth is one of the most valuable contributions you can make, and is what inspires real change in the world - Why food forests are our future and how we can grow our own food anywhere, even in northern climates - Why and how Carly and Brenden started giving up possessions and living minimally, and why it brings them so much joy, connection and serenity (Documentary recommendations: Minimalism on Netflix) - Eco-spirituality and the benefits of camping and being in connection with the earth. Carly Bergman is an eco-influencer, author + consultant, with a degree in Integrated Studies, concentrating on sustainability + eco-spirituality, in addition to being certified in permaculture design. She's the creator of the #FuturisticFebruary challenge, which raises awareness on unsustainable consumerism in today's society. Carly + her partner Brenden, (who will also be on the podcast soon!) run a consulting firm called Sustainable Duo, where they travel around the country speaking at vegan + zero waste events.
